Output 5594ddecde67d30aa9221f13ce96b033fd5c9da4807c1bceb5cef3fd9e84bbf2:1

value
3566816
script pubkey
OP_0 OP_PUSHBYTES_20 3d246fcfb78a09317c45706dc4172a401f8aa42b
address
bc1q85jxlnah3gynzlz9wpkug9e2gq0c4fpte0qja7
transaction
5594ddecde67d30aa9221f13ce96b033fd5c9da4807c1bceb5cef3fd9e84bbf2
confirmations
130947
spent
true